diff options
| author | Even Rouault <even.rouault@mines-paris.org> | 2015-06-21 01:14:24 +0200 |
|---|---|---|
| committer | Even Rouault <even.rouault@mines-paris.org> | 2015-06-21 01:14:24 +0200 |
| commit | 96d7e6ddcb75e37cc2fdf8009be1fe7769027cb1 (patch) | |
| tree | afead182b27e340846a98ee8628521a461972c79 | |
| parent | 06c19623e194257975172cccc9072163a2610e77 (diff) | |
| download | PROJ-96d7e6ddcb75e37cc2fdf8009be1fe7769027cb1.tar.gz PROJ-96d7e6ddcb75e37cc2fdf8009be1fe7769027cb1.zip | |
.travis.yml: attempt to fix coveralls with libtool
| -rw-r--r-- | .travis.yml | 3 | ||||
| -rwxr-xr-x | libtool | 14 |
2 files changed, 8 insertions, 9 deletions
diff --git a/.travis.yml b/.travis.yml index 860dd47f..2aa13779 100644 --- a/.travis.yml +++ b/.travis.yml @@ -53,8 +53,7 @@ install: # autoconf build with grids and coverage - CFLAGS="--coverage" LDFLAGS="-lgcov" ./configure - make -j3 - - cd src/.libs - - for i in ../*.c; do ln -s $i .; done + - mv src/.libs/*.gc* src - cd ../.. - make check @@ -2,7 +2,7 @@ # libtool - Provide generalized library-building support services. # Generated automatically by config.status (proj) 4.9.1 -# Libtool was configured on host vagrant-ubuntu-trusty-32: +# Libtool was configured on host even-desktop: # NOTE: Changes made to this file will be lost: look at ltmain.sh. # # Copyright (C) 1996, 1997, 1998, 1999, 2000, 2001, 2003, 2004, 2005, @@ -66,12 +66,12 @@ PATH_SEPARATOR=":" # The host system. host_alias= -host=i686-pc-linux-gnu +host=x86_64-unknown-linux-gnu host_os=linux-gnu # The build system. build_alias= -build=i686-pc-linux-gnu +build=x86_64-unknown-linux-gnu build_os=linux-gnu # A sed program that does not truncate output. @@ -164,7 +164,7 @@ lock_old_archive_extraction=no LTCC="gcc" # LTCC compiler flags. -LTCFLAGS="-g -O2" +LTCFLAGS="--coverage" # Take the output of nm and produce a listing of raw symbols and C names. global_symbol_pipe="sed -n -e 's/^.*[ ]\\([ABCDGIRSTW][ABCDGIRSTW]*\\)[ ][ ]*\\([_A-Za-z][_A-Za-z0-9]*\\)\$/\\1 \\2 \\2/p' | sed '/ __gnu_lto/d'" @@ -272,10 +272,10 @@ finish_eval="" hardcode_into_libs=yes # Compile-time system search path for libraries. -sys_lib_search_path_spec="/usr/lib/gcc/i686-linux-gnu/4.8 /usr/lib/i386-linux-gnu /usr/lib /lib/i386-linux-gnu /lib " +sys_lib_search_path_spec="/usr/lib/gcc/x86_64-linux-gnu/4.4.3 /usr/lib /lib /usr/lib/x86_64-linux-gnu " # Run-time system search path for libraries. -sys_lib_dlsearch_path_spec="/lib /usr/lib /usr/lib/i386-linux-gnu/libfakeroot /usr/lib/i386-linux-gnu/mesa /lib/i386-linux-gnu /usr/lib/i386-linux-gnu /lib/i686-linux-gnu /usr/lib/i686-linux-gnu /usr/local/lib " +sys_lib_dlsearch_path_spec="/lib /usr/lib /usr/lib/fglrx /usr/lib32/fglrx /usr/lib/atlas /usr/lib32/alsa-lib /usr/lib/alsa-lib /usr/local/lib /lib/x86_64-linux-gnu /usr/lib/x86_64-linux-gnu " # Whether dlopen is supported. dlopen_support=unknown @@ -292,7 +292,7 @@ striplib="strip --strip-unneeded" # The linker used to build libraries. -LD="/usr/bin/ld" +LD="/usr/bin/ld -m elf_x86_64" # How to create reloadable object files. reload_flag=" -r" |
